在同一台机器上开发环境用.net 2.0 + office 2003生成word 文件没有任何问题,
但当程序发布在iis上,在生成word文件过程中 系统提示 --- 内存不够,无法保存文件,
开发和发布都是在同一台机器上,可以肯定组件没有问题,也不是什么病毒的问题,而且dcom也设置过了没有安全限制。还请哪位有经验的朋友帮忙解决一下多谢

解决方案 »

  1.   

    曾经在导出EXCEL文件好像遇到过这个问题,后来打了office补丁就好用了,不知道你的问题是否和我的一样!
      

  2.   

    在给web.config的<system.web>下添加<identity impersonate="true" userName="administrator" password="admin"/>这句话不然会出现"内存不足,请现在保存文档"提示错误。
      

  3.   

    共享个示例:C# word控件编程1、使用代码直接创建word文件,同时可以添加页眉、内容、图片及表格,示例代码:
     
    2、使用C# word控件WinWordControl,加载word文件为母版,等于打开这个word文件编辑后另存为word
      

  4.   

    还有一个office控件-- SOAOffice2010 中间件
    不过不是免费的。